The new electric car models are seriously impressive! Cant wait to see them on the road!
The new electric car models are seriously impressive! Cant w...
Your browser doesn't support HTML5 video
Your browser doesn't support HTML5 video
The new electric car models are seriously impressive! Cant wait to see them on the road!